Thanks Nathan,

We've also got Costaglioli's SQL2CSV for creating csv files.  We
actually needed the XLS specifically, because it also lets us use a
template excel file to put headers and define column widths and what-not
on our output.

The good news is I found the problem.  It was the authority to the
/excel directory which contained the /poi-2.0.jar file.

|We use Beppe Costagliola's SQL2XLS program, which in turn uses the
|Jakarta POI API's to create Excel files in the IFS.
|
|Typically, we have submitted jobs which call the SQL2XLSR program,
|passing the SQL string and other parms, with good results, but until
now
|the jobs have always been sumbitted from a user profile which has
fairly
|high authority.
|
|We implemented an application yesterday which allows our users to
choose
|an option on a screen which submits a job to handle this function, and
|it returns the following error:
|
|RPG procedure SQL2XLSR in program GNMPPGM/SQL2XLSR
|
|received Java exception "java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Error:
|
|
|org/apache/poi/hssf/usermodel/HSSFWorkbook" when calling method
"<init>"
|
|
|with signature "()V" in class
|"org.apache.poi.hssf.usermodel.HSSFWorkbook".
|
|I have seen this error before, when we were using the SQL2XLS program
|interactively, because there was an indentically named method used by
|our order entry application which of course had a different signature,
|and this caused a conflict.  Since this is happening now in a submitted
|job, I don't think this conflict could be the problem.
|
|Upon googling the error, I found some discussion on the MCPress site
|where Beppe tells some people that it was caused by having the wrong
|version of the POI, but this seems to be applicable to situations where
|the thing won't work at all on the system.
|
|My inclination is to believe this is an authority issue, but the
|question is, authority to what ?  I've checked and opened wide the
|authorities to the IFS directories and files being used by the
|application, and even opened up the authorities on the poi-2.5.jar
file,
|to no avail.
|
|Anyone have any other ideas ?
